Site Safety Manager

4 months ago


Newnan, United States MasTec Inc. Full time

Overview

The Site Safety Manager is responsible for, but not limited to supporting project site crews and Safety Specialists by visiting project sites, assessing the project site for unsafe work conditions, and working with project managers, project site supervision and safety personnel to properly control and minimize risks and hazards to protect employees, subcontractors and the customer.

Company Overview

Founded by Sam Saiia as Birmingham Excavating Co. in 1946, the company now known as Saiia is an industrial heavy civil contractor of choice for the power generation, mineral and aggregate mining, and pulp and paper markets. With more than 630 pieces of construction machinery in our fleet, over 500 employees, and experience working in 11 states, we have the resources and knowledge to complete projects of any scale.

Saiia is a subsidiary of Infrastructure and Energy Alternatives, Inc. (IEA), a leading infrastructure construction company with specialized energy and heavy civil expertise. In 2022, IEA and its affiliated companies were acquired by MasTec and are now part of the organization's Clean Energy and Infrastructure segment.

MasTec's Clean Energy and Infrastructure Group (CE&I) is a $2 billion annual revenue business unit that provides construction services for industrial facilities; building products manufacturers, power generation facilities, manufacturing plants; solar, wind, and thermal energy plants; buildings, and infrastructure.

Responsibilities

* Preview projects and project sites before work begins to determine safety and environmental related risks.


* Develops project site specific safety plan, EAP (Emergency Action Plan) and training for project sites.


* Sits on assigned site full time to assess ongoing work conditions to ensure compliance with project site specific safety plans, and local, state and federal regulations.


* Documents unsafe work conditions, safety hazards and health hazards.


* Works with project management, site supervision and craft workers to develop and implement solutions to safety related findings on project sites.


* Determines corrective or preventative measures where necessary and follows up to ensure corrective and preventive measures are implemented.


* Manages contractors' safety programs and training; recommends changes as necessary for compliance.


* Audits orientation and annual safety training records for compliance.


* Conducts investigations of accidents and injuries through employee interviews, equipment inspections and site inspections, carefully reviewing the integrity of personal protective equipment, materials, and project site specific gear.


* Provides updates to the Project Manager and Director of Safety.


* Ensures all required records and reports are up to date, accurate and submitted to comply with all internal processes, local, state, and federal regulations.


* Ensures project sites have the appropriate safety equipment.


* Manages Safety Specialists at project sites where assigned.


* Performs all other duties as assigned by the Director of Safety.



Qualifications

* A minimum of 5 years construction safety managerial experience or equivalent combination of training and related experience.


* Experience and/or training in Heavy Equipment, Excavation, Trenching, and Soil Mechanics preferred.


* Knowledge of and experience with OSHA, regulations and reporting processes and procedures for construction safety.


* Ability to professionally represent the company when dealing with external organizations, regulatory bodies and with all organizational levels internally.
* Ability to communicate and train effectively.


* Ability to read, analyze, and interpret general business periodicals, professional journals, technical procedures, or governmental regulations.


* Ability to exercise good business judgment and common sense when making recommendations and decisions.


* Ability to multi-task and thrive in an environment where numerous tasks and projects are occurring simultaneously.


* Ability to meet deadlines in short time frames.


* Strong interpersonal skills: ability to interact and with all levels of the company at project sites and offices, and effectively deal with vendors, subcontractors, customers, and regulatory agencies.


* Ability to deal with problems involving several concrete variables in standardized situations.



Supervisory Responsibilities:

* Plans, organizes, and manages the work of the Safety Specialists to ensure the work is accomplished in a manner consistent with organizational expectations and requirements.


* Provide guidance to team members and monitors their performance, discipline, and attendance on regular basis.


* Responsible for professional development of Safety Specialists.


* Communicates and acts with a team-oriented mentality.


* Ensure positive morale and engagement of employees.


* Communicates and adheres to Company vision and values.


* Assist in employee recruitment, performance management, promotions, retention, and termination activities.



Work Environment:

* While performing the duties of this position, the employee frequently works in outside weather conditions. Exposure consists of hot and cold temperatures and/or wet/humid conditions.


* The employee regularly works near moving mechanical parts.


* The employee regularly works in precarious places.


* The employee is regularly exposed to fumes or airborne particles.


* The noise level in the work environment can be loud.



Licenses and Certifications:

* Must have and maintain a valid state issued Driver's License with driving record that meets Saiia's risk management guidelines.


* One of the following ACTIVE certifications is required: CHST, OSHA 500, or Bachelor's Degree in Safety & Health
* First Aid /CPR/AED Instructor Certification



Travel:

* This position will be assigned full time to one project site and report to that site daily. Should company project needs change, this position is expected to travel to and report to a different job site as required.

Educational Requirements:

* Minimum of a High School Diploma or equivalent.


* Bachelor's Degree in Safety or related discipline preferred.
